
Start by locating the main electrical distribution unit under the dashboard, on the driver’s side. This unit controls several key systems, including lights, wipers, and air conditioning. You can access it by removing the lower kick panel or trim, depending on the model. Check for visible labels to help identify the connections for various circuits.
If the primary unit does not solve your issue, inspect the engine compartment. The secondary power distribution unit is usually found near the battery and is responsible for managing high-power components like the fuel pump and ignition. Look for a plastic cover labeled with the components it controls. Be sure to check that the cover is intact to prevent moisture from damaging the connections.
Inspect each connection for corrosion or signs of damage. Over time, the terminals and relays can deteriorate, causing electrical failures. If you find a damaged part, replace it with one that matches the original specifications. Pay close attention to the amperage ratings to avoid overheating and ensure proper function of the system. Regularly checking these components will prevent future electrical issues and ensure reliable vehicle performance.

Understanding the Connections
- The larger components are typically relays that manage high-power systems, such as the ignition system and air conditioning.
- Smaller terminals control lower-power components like the interior lights, radio, and climate control systems.
- Make sure to label each terminal when replacing a part to avoid confusion and improper connections.
Always check for corrosion or damage on the terminals. Over time, connections can become loose, rusted, or worn out, leading to unreliable operation. If you find any corrosion, clean the terminals with electrical contact cleaner or replace the damaged components with the correct specifications. Taking these steps will help ensure your vehicle runs smoothly.
Replacing Damaged Components

When replacing any part, always use the same type and rating as the original. This ensures that the new part fits within the electrical system and prevents overheating or malfunction. Pay attention to the amperage ratings when replacing relays or connectors. Failure to do so can cause further electrical issues, resulting in potential damage to the vehicle’s wiring or even fire hazards.
